When you come on this island, you will be surprised that some pigs are living here. They came from Koh Tan, they swam across the sea to live on this island. Pig Island is famous for having white sandy beaches and views of the Koh Samui coastline. Invite you to enjoy their serenity, their clean sand, and their clear and calm waters. Pig island from Koh Samui only 20 min by speed boat.

The speedboat to pig island was great, the island itself was beautiful if a bit busy, and the snorkelling amongst tiger fish incredible,
Now for the negative.
There’s used to be 27 pigs until swine flue arrived, now there are just 2 ! All the others died, 1 pig called “ lucky” and another laying with a broken leg! Presumably called unlucky, so sad to see,
If you book this imagining playing with the cute baby pigs on the beach you will be sadly disappointed
